Why Trump Is Such an Important Character in Economic History

Summary:
Jul.26 -- Thomas Palley, an independent economist and author of "From Financial Crisis to Stagnation," explains why President Donald Trump is such an important character in global economic history. He speaks with Bloomberg's Joe Weisenthal, Scarlet Fu and Julie Hyman on "What'd You Miss?"

Thomas Palley
Dr. Thomas Palley is an economist living in Washington DC. He holds a B.A. degree from Oxford University, and a M.A. degree in International Relations and Ph.D. in Economics, both from Yale University.
